Pros: Perfect size, not too small, not too big. Not heavy at all. Love the touchscreen aspect of it, I use the touchscreen alot. I was able to connect to my home printer, so it is convenient to be able to print from my chromebook. Cons: I do not like that there is not a Delete button, there is only a Backspace button which is a bit inconvenient. Also there is no CapsLock button, you have to go into the settings to assign a key to be CapsLock. So that was inconvenient when I first got the chromebook, until I went in and adjusted the setting to my liking. So now I have my Capslock button in the normal spot. Overall: I would recommend this chromebook for quick access to on-the-go work.

I'm totally thrilled with the Acer Chromebook R 11 2-in-1. Make sure you get the newer model with the quad-core Celeron N3160 and 4GB of RAM - you should get 32GB of storage too.
Here's what I like:
1. It's fast! Load a large page like cnn.com with lots of graphics and it will take a little time for everything to finish but even that is acceptable, the top loads fast, and everything else is fast in general.
2. It seems to run many Android apps very well! We've been playing some board games on it, like Tsuro and Ticket to Ride. It's great having a larger screen and the games play perfectly! Looking forward to playing Settlers of Catan on it!
3. Netflix works great on it! Video starts quickly and looks great, sure it's only 1366x768 but at 11.6" it really doesn't matter. The video looks excellent.
4. Battery life is great! Yeah, it will depend what you're doing but the first night I got it I was installing Android apps, trying web sites and watched a 45 minute show on Netflix and it was still at 75% after that.
5. I love having a 2-in-1!!! It's really needed with a touch screen and it's hand for games, some apps, and viewing photos and video.
6. Audio has good volume and sounds fine!
7. The whole family loves it!
8. The price...You get so much for the money!!! It's the best device I've seen for $300 by far!
What I don't like:
1. Sure, Android compatibility isn't perfect yet. I can't think of what didn't work but I think I had one app that would not install. I've done a number of games and productivity apps with great results.

The on sale Acer R11 at $ 249 proved to be excellent value and surpassed expectations : I had been looking to replace an old Samsung Tab tablet that was becoming increasingly slower in order to browse the web , listen and cast music and perform basic notes and apps responses. I thought I would try Chrome OS
Pros
Set up straight forward using google accpunt ( recommend you obtain google account for this OS if you do not already have one)
Boots and starts up very quickly even from power off.
Basic google chrome programs very responsive.(Also has Android app compatibility on this platform although I hve not tried too many todate.)
Screen is quite good for the price and sharp although not the highest resolution available (but be aware of cost of other tablets etc) plus you can chromecast or use hdmi interface if inclined for hi res (though I havent tried yet)
WLAN is fast and smooth particualry in high band.
Bluetooth audio works great with old legacy BT headphiones though took about 30 secs to find initially.
Browsing is very fast , as is download (providing your broadband is fast !!)
I added external MMC card without any issues; quickly identiied BUT you must know where to look(in filemanager app and or via control rectangle bottom right of screen.)
Audio is quite good for small device (my view is different to some reviwers)
Battery life is excellent.
Touch pad works quite well (despite what some reviews have said about earlier models)
Keyboard is similarly response.good tactile response but not made for heavy typing as relatively small.
Touch screen functions fine BUT the apps and interface is NOT set up as an ANDROID MS WIN nor Apple Pad so do not expect simalar interface at all.
Microphone and camera worked straight away no issues.
CONS
Off line (internet) capability is very limited but still able to listen to music and do some basic editing (using google keep) Its really meant for internet access.
Text editing is extremely limited and difficult offline in chrome os mode and does not interface to other apps easily. I have not tried an android compatible app for this gap as of yet.(Text editing and document creation online is great either via google docs or MS XX office !!)
Recommendations
Buy the latest model withe 32GB and 4GB memory and NOT an earlier model or be aware of earlier review comments reviews and limitations.
Read setup and obtain google acount if you do not alreasy have one preferably before buying device for ease of set up.

We were shopping for a Surface (which I already have) when I suggested to my daughter to try this out. She loved it right away and was sure that it would be good enough for her school work.
That was a $500+ conversation because even the least expensive Surface costs a lot more than this class of machine. For her, i's an ideal, low-cost device. She's a high school freshman whose school district has standardized on Google Documents, so this fit might be better for us than it could potentially be for others. That being said, if you subscribe to Office 365 or can do other things cloud-based, this will definitely work. You do have to be online to use most of its functions, but because she uses it exclusively at our house, this isn't an issue.
It only takes about 5-minutes to set it up, it's easy to use, and doubles as a tablet because it's a touch screen. I'm sure this will be good enough for her for a few years, possibly even the next 4 because local processing power is not really important.

This is my first Chromebook, and I believe I'm now officially a fan of this OS. Booting up, hopping on the internet and leaving countless tabs open is lightning fast and smooth. I'm still learning my way around, in terms of storage (included cloud storage), device settings, keyboard functions and "tricks," but so far, I am really enjoying it. Plus, the Chromebook rep (Dustin) at my Best Buy store gave me his hours, so that I could stop by anytime for assistance! Since I have had this little puppy, I have hardly even touched my iPad. I love the convenience of being able to go from mouse (or track pad) to touch screen, depending on which app interacts better.
Perhaps, my favorite quality of the Chromebook platform is that this laptop never gets hot or noisy (there's no fan whirring inside). It's solid state, so it doesn't overheat.
I couldn't give it a full 5 stars, because the keyboard isn't backlit; something I miss when using it in bed at night. Then again, for the VERY affordable price this is, that's probably a feature that Acer's designers felt was cut-able in this price range. I also miss the delete key when making forward corrections during typing.
